Despite a rocky year for the New Orleans Saints, four rookies have stolen the spotlight by making ESPN’s All-Rookie Team. Tyler Shough, who’s already in the Rookie of the Year conversation, leads the pack, proving that the team’s draft “risks” paid off. Alongside him, Quincy Riley, Kelvin Banks Jr., and Jonas Sanker have all stepped up in big ways. Banks has anchored the left tackle spot like a seasoned pro, while Riley’s aggressive play at cornerback hints at a promising future.
